1.) What can you do to find out what your customers want? Give some methods.
Before you start promoting your business you need to know what your customers want
and why. Good customer research helps you work out how to convince your customers that
they need your products and services. The first step of customer research is identifying your
customers. Your market research should help you understand your potential customers. Further
customer research can help you develop a more detailed picture of them and understand how to
target them. It will also highlight key characteristics your customers share, such as, gender, age,
occupation, disposable income, residential location, recreational activities.
